Jogging around Sharonville provides access to extensive green spaces and diverse natural features, primarily centered around its parks. The region features a mix of paved and natural trails, often winding through forested areas and alongside bodies of water. Notable geological features, such as fossil-rich shale and limestone, are present in some areas, offering a unique backdrop for running. These routes cater to various preferences, from flat lake loops to paths with gentle elevation changes.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many running routes are available in Sharonville?

There are over 50 dedicated running routes around Sharonville, offering a variety of experiences. Most of these, about 50, are rated as moderate, with a few easy and difficult options also available.

What kind of terrain can I expect on jogging trails in Sharonville?

Sharonville's jogging trails feature a mix of paved and natural paths. You'll find routes winding through extensive green spaces, forested gorges, and alongside bodies of water, such as the scenic Sharon Woods Lake. Some areas, like the Gorge Trail, even showcase fascinating geological features like fossil-rich shale and limestone.

Are there any family-friendly running paths in Sharonville?

Yes, Sharonville offers several family-friendly options. The Sharon Woods Lake loop from Heritage Village Museum is an easy 2.9-mile paved path that circles the lake, providing scenic views and a flat surface suitable for all ages. Sharon Woods itself is a large park with many recreational opportunities.

Can I bring my dog on the jogging trails in Sharonville?

Many parks in the Great Parks of Hamilton County system, including Sharon Woods, are dog-friendly, typically requiring dogs to be on a leash. It's always best to check specific park regulations before heading out, but generally, you'll find options for running with your leashed companion.

Are there any waterfalls or scenic viewpoints along the running routes?

Absolutely! The Sharon Woods Gorge Trail is a standout, offering tranquil scenery and overlooks. Along this trail, you can easily access Buckeye Falls, a picturesque 10-foot waterfall. The Sharon Woods Lake also provides beautiful scenic views.

What do other runners say about the trails in Sharonville?

The running routes in Sharonville are highly rated by the komoot community, with an average score of 4.3 stars. Over 300 runners have explored the area, often praising the extensive green spaces, varied terrain, and the well-maintained paths within parks like Sharon Woods.

Are there any easy jogging routes for beginners in Sharonville?

Yes, for beginners or those seeking a relaxed run, the Sharon Woods Lake loop from Heritage Village Museum is an excellent choice. This easy 2.9-mile path offers a flat surface and beautiful lake views, perfect for a gentle introduction to running in the area.

Are there circular running routes available in Sharonville?

Many of the running paths in Sharonville are designed as loops, providing convenient circular routes. For example, the Sharon Woods Lake loop from Heritage Village Museum and the Todd Pond loop from Montgomery are popular circular options.

What are some notable landmarks or points of interest I might see while running?

Beyond the natural beauty, you might encounter historical elements. The Sharon Woods Gorge Trail, for instance, showcases remnants of a former footbridge and is rich in marine fossils from the Ordovician Period. The nearby Lookout Tower also offers panoramic views.

Is there parking available at the trailheads for running routes?

Yes, parks like Sharon Woods, Gorman Park, and Summit Park (nearby in Blue Ash) typically offer ample parking facilities for visitors accessing their trails. It's always a good idea to check specific park websites for any parking fees or detailed directions.

Are there any shaded running trails for summer jogging in Sharonville?

Many of Sharonville's trails, particularly those within Sharon Woods and the Gorge Trail, wind through forested areas, providing welcome shade during warmer months. These natural settings offer a cooler and more pleasant running experience in summer.
